Class   Serial
   
Name  

lastChar()

   
Examples  
// Example by Tom Igoe 
 
import processing.serial.*; 
 
Serial myPort;  // The serial port: 
 
void setup() { 
  // List all the available serial ports: 
  println(Serial.list()); 
 
  // I know that the first port in the serial list on my mac 
  // is always my  Keyspan adaptor, so I open Serial.list()[0]. 
  // Open whatever port is the one you're using. 
  myPort = new Serial(this, Serial.list()[0], 9600); 
  myPort.write(45); 
} 
 
void draw() { 
  while (myPort.available() > 0) { 
    char lastIn = myPort.lastChar(); 
    println(lastIn); 
  } 
} 
 

Description   Returns the last byte received as a char.
   
Syntax  
serial.lastchar()
   
Parameters  
serial   any variable of type Serial

   
Returns   int
   
Usage   Web & Application
